Under The Feathers Of God
Christy Nockels' song 'Under the Feathers of God' is a worship piece that draws on Psalm 91 to express trust in God's protection and peace. The lyrics speak of not fearing darkness or storms because the Lord is a refuge and shelter. The imagery of being held under God's wings conveys safety and rest. The song moves from present troubles to a future hope of dwelling with God forever, ending with a commitment to worship His name. It's a calming, reassuring anthem for those seeking comfort and security in God's presence.
